Abstract
Aims A longitudinal and comprehensive analysis of health‐related quality of life ( HRQOL ) was performed during hospitalization for heart failure ( HF ) or soon after discharge. Methods and results A post‐hoc analysis was performed of the ASCEND‐HF trial.
